PeacefulAnarchy wrote: »ZOS_JessicaFolsom wrote: »If you chose ruckus you're instanced with other ruckus players and they have the least population
This is not accurate. Players are not given priority to be instanced with players of the same Faction. There may be fewer players in the Ruckus District right now because folks are prioritizing a different District, but that is not how instancing in the Night Market works. When players enter the main hub and Districts, they join based on when they entered until the zone cap is hit, then a new instance spins up. That's it.
